Output 8a950e042d6c8299587ae68c101f782894bbad7ada613a242e1a7b2175bd2e8d:0

value
708829082
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48e25ba357a58a36e3e137391e4dafb1633877d0 OP_EQUALVERIFY OP_CHECKSIG
address
17eNpSSdttMErJ3RK7TKPJ3mVcPgrobdsV
transaction
8a950e042d6c8299587ae68c101f782894bbad7ada613a242e1a7b2175bd2e8d
confirmations
598597
spent
true